PILOT PLANT SHUTDOWN AND Pu-Al PROCESSING (open access)

PILOT PLANT SHUTDOWN AND Pu-Al PROCESSING

The large aqueous pilot plant facilities at ORNL were cleaned and are being put in standby condition. Experience was gained during the year as anion exchange was used to recover more than one kg of plutonium left in the exploded evaporator system. This experience is being applied to a new recovery program just beginning in cell 1 of Building 4507. (auth)

A cryogenic system design for the international thermonuclear experimental reactor (ITER) (open access)

A cryogenic system design for the international thermonuclear experimental reactor (ITER)

A conceptual design for ITER was completed last year. The author developed a suitable cryogenic system for ITER as part of this conceptual design effort. An overview of the design is reported. Emphasis is on the fact that cryogenics is a mature science, and a system supporting ITER needs can be made from time-proven components without loss of efficiency or reliability. Because of the large size of the ITER cryogenic system, large numbers of compressors and expanders must be used. Very high reliability is assured by arranging these components in parallel banks where servicing of individual components can be done without interruption of operations. This and other ideas based on the author's experience with Mirror Fusion Test Facility (MFTF) operations are described. 5 refs., 3 figs.

GRAPHITE-STAINLESS STEEL COMPATIBILITY STUDIES (open access)

GRAPHITE-STAINLESS STEEL COMPATIBILITY STUDIES

S>The compatibility of type 304L stainless steel in intimate contact with graphite is being studied as a function of temperature and contact pressure. This study is an outgrowth of materials compatibility problems in present and advanced gas-cooled reactors, where structural members in direct contact with graphite provide the possibility of both carburization and self-welding. Initial studies were concerned with surface reactions in the absence of gaseous contaminants under a vacuum of 10/sup -6/ mm Hg at 540 to 705 deg C. Stainless steel specimens are pretreated to provide three surface conditions: H/sub 2/- fired, preoxidized, and Cu-plated. Surface contact pressures ranged from 0 to 10,000 psi. Test results are presented which establish the lower temperature limit for significant diffusion between graphite and stainless steel at approximately 60O deg C. Above this temperature, diffusion between untreated or H2-fired stainless steel surfaces was found to effect complete bonding of the two materials at contact pressures as low as 500 psi. Bonding was effectively prevented by the presence of either an oxide film or a Cu plate at temperatures up to 700 deg C. Results of TMX operations: January-July 1980 (open access)

Results of TMX operations: January-July 1980

This interim report summarizes results from the Tandem Mirror Experiment (TMX) during the period January to July 1980 and describes the physics experiments, the machine operation, and the diagnostics that were added to TMX during this period. This operating period followed the initial proof-of-principle TMX experiments and predated the ongoing final experiments preceding TMX shutdown for modification to TMX Upgrade. The results described in this report include measurements of plasma parameters and plasma behavior which confirm the initial TMX results that demonstrated that the tandem mirror configuration can be generated and sustained by neutral beam injection and that the tandem mirror configuration improves confinement of magnetic mirror systems.

Numerical simulation of the stability in a cable-in-conduit conductor developed for fusion-magnet applications (open access)

Numerical simulation of the stability in a cable-in-conduit conductor developed for fusion-magnet applications

The stability margins of the US-Demonstration Poloidal Coil (US-DPC) and the International Thermonuclear Experimental Reactor (ITER) TF coils have been modeled numerically using the computer program CICC. The computed US-DPC limiting current, I{sub lim}, compares favorably with the values determined experimentally. Using the detailed program CICC output, we investigated the DPC quench initiation mechanism in each of the three stability regions. In the ill-cooled region, the imposed heat pulse heats the conductor to the current-sharing temperature, T{sub cs}. In the transition region, the resistance heating after the pulse must be strong enough to overcome the induced flow reversal. In the well-cooled region, good heat transfer heats the helium during the pulse. After the pulse, these high helium temperatures along with poor heat transfer cause the conductor to quench. Changes in I{sub lim} agree with Dresner's relationship. I{sub lim} can be improved by decreasing the copper resistivity, the helium fraction, or the conductor diameter. Preliminary results show the ITER and TF coil operating point is in the well-cooled region. 10 refs., 7 figs., 1 tab.

Current drive and heating systems for an ITER HARD option (open access)

Current drive and heating systems for an ITER HARD option

A conceptual design has been developed for a reference current drive and heating system for a HARD (High Aspect Ratio Design) option for ITER. Twelve neutral beam modules, each rated at 1.3MeV and 9.2MW, perform plasma heating and current drive. An electron cyclotron system is used for initiating the plasma and for disruption control. An alternate system has been defined which is comprised of a lower hybrid and ion cyclotron system for heating and current drive, augmented by the same electron cyclotron system proposed for the reference system. 7 refs., 8 figs., 1 tab.

New tools using the hardware performance monitor to help users tune programs on the Cray X-MP (open access)

New tools using the hardware performance monitor to help users tune programs on the Cray X-MP

The performance of a Cray system is highly dependent on the tuning techniques used by individuals on their codes. Many of our users were not taking advantage of the tuning tools that allow them to monitor their own programs by using the Hardware Performance Monitor (HPM). We therefore modified UNICOS to collect HPM data for all processes and to report Mflop ratings based on users, programs, and time used. Our tuning efforts are now being focused on the users and programs that have the best potential for performance improvements. These modifications and some of the more striking performance improvements are described.

Staff management of security personnel at Martin Marietta Energy Systems, Inc. , Portsmouth Gaseous Diffusion Plant (open access)

Staff management of security personnel at Martin Marietta Energy Systems, Inc. , Portsmouth Gaseous Diffusion Plant

The Portsmouth Gaseous Diffusion Plant Security and Police Operations Department is responsible for protecting the US Department of Energy interests at the Portsmouth Plant from theft, sabotage, and other hostile acts that may adversely affect national security, the public health and safety, or property at the Department of Energy facility. This audit's purpose was to evaluate Martin Marietta Energy Systems, Inc.'s staff management at the Portsmouth Plant Security Department. The Portsmouth Plant Security Department could reduce operating cost up to an estimated $4.4 million over 5 years by: (1) Eliminating up to 14 unnecessary staff positions, and (2) reducing the length of relief breaks. These economies could be realized through implementing written operating procedures and negotiating removal of certain labor union restrictions. 2 tabs.

Motor Fuels: Stakeholder Views on Compensating for the Effects of Gasoline Temperature on Volume at the Pump (open access)

Motor Fuels: Stakeholder Views on Compensating for the Effects of Gasoline Temperature on Volume at the Pump

A letter report issued by the Government Accountability Office with an abstract that begins "The volume, but not the energy content, of hydrocarbon fuels, such as gasoline and diesel, varies in response to changes in temperature. Thus, because of expansion, the energy content per gallon of 90 degree fuel is less than that of 60 degree fuel. States and localities adopt and enforce weights and measures regulations, often using the model regulatory standards published by the National Institute of Standards and Technology (NIST). Although technology now exists to compensate for the effects of temperature on gas volume, the costs of doing so at the retail level have become the subject of much debate among weights and measures officials, consumer groups, and representatives of the petroleum and fuel marketing industries. GAO was asked to provide information on (1) the views of U.S. stakeholders on the costs to implement automatic temperature compensation, (2) the views of U.S. stakeholders on who would bear these costs, and (3) the reasons some state and national governments have adopted or rejected automatic temperature compensation. Central America: U.S. Agencies Considered Various Factors in Funding Security Activities, but Need to Assess Progress in Achieving Interagency Objectives (open access)

Central America: U.S. Agencies Considered Various Factors in Funding Security Activities, but Need to Assess Progress in Achieving Interagency Objectives

A letter report issued by the Government Accountability Office with an abstract that begins "Since fiscal year 2008, U.S. agencies allocated over $1.2 billion in funding for Central America Regional Security Initiative (CARSI) activities and non-CARSI funding that supports CARSI goals. As of June 1, 2013, the Department of State (State) and the United States Agency for International Development (USAID) obligated at least $463 million of the close to $495 million in allocated funding for CARSI activities, and disbursed at least $189 million to provide partner countries with equipment, technical assistance, and training to improve interdiction and disrupt criminal networks. Moreover, as of March 31, 2013, U.S. agencies estimated that they had allocated approximately $708 million in non-CARSI funding that supports CARSI goals, but data on disbursements were not readily available. U.S. agencies, including State, the Department of Defense (DOD), and the Department of Justice, use this funding to provide equipment, technical assistance, and training, as well as infrastructure and investigation assistance to partner countries. For example, DOD allocated $25 million in funding to help Guatemala establish an interagency border unit to combat drug trafficking."

Combating Terrorism: DHS Should Take Action to Better Ensure Resources Abroad Align with Priorities (open access)

Combating Terrorism: DHS Should Take Action to Better Ensure Resources Abroad Align with Priorities

A letter report issued by the Government Accountability Office with an abstract that begins "The Department of Homeland Security (DHS) carries out a variety of programs and activities abroad within its areas of expertise that could have the effect of thwarting terrorists and their plots while also combating other categories of transnational crime, and DHS expended approximately $451 million on programs and activities abroad in fiscal year 2012. For example, through the Visa Security Program, DHS has deployed personnel abroad to help prevent the issuance of visas to people who might pose a threat. As of May 2013, DHS has stationed about 1,800 employees in almost 80 countries to conduct these and other activities. In addition, DHS has delivered training and technical assistance in areas such as border and aviation security to officials from about 180 countries to enhance partner nations' security capacities."
